Well 50x50 does not sound like a lot.
webbed in the bed it could be enough.
If you decide to go 50x50 at least make sure it is 4 or better 5mm wall thickness, much easier with tapping threads.
For the size i would go 80x80x4
The main thing is your total footprint.
It is 1000x700 right?
When you can run FEA on your design you know.
I did some basic checks on my design.
Quickly went for 80x80x4 bed and 80x120x4 gantry parts.
Get end caps on the box section.
I think you need to make the gantry as rigid as reasonably possible.
You can easily make the gantry 80x120...
Massive impact on rigidity.
Only 3 cm extra in the design.
